我在html文件中有以下元素
<div id="u11" class="ax_default image" data-label="image1">
<img id="u11_img" class="img " src="images/image1_u11.png">
</div>
<div id="u23" class="ax_default image" data-label="image2">
<img id="u23_img" class="img " src="images/image2_u23.png">
</div>
我想为另一个将image2设置src
为image1的元素编写一个javascript onclick函数src
问题是id是随机的,所以我不能使用它们,幸运的是我可以使用data-label
来获取外部div对象$('[data-label=image1]')
¿如何在内部img中设置src?
您可以使用以下内容
var image1 = document.querySelector('[data-label="image1"] img'),
image2 = document.querySelector('[data-label="image2"] img');
document.querySelector('#button').addEventListener('click', function(){
image2.src = image1.src;
});
本文收集自互联网,转载请注明来源。
如有侵权,请联系 [email protected] 删除。
我来说两句